Catalog description

The answers to this question will be read—deciphered—in the many “reading scenes” found throughout the history of literature or philosophy. In Plato’s Phaedrus , reading thus appears caught in a network of desire and power: the dominant role—the erases (“lover”) who writes and teaches—and the passive or submissive position—the eromenos (“beloved”) who reads and learns—are constantly permutated and destabilized. Hobbes’ Leviathan , Melville’s Moby Dick and Billy Budd , Goethe’s and Valéry’s Faust will lead us to question what we do when we read and reflect upon what could be called a politics of reading .
